Practice-It! logo

BJP3 Self-Check 3.8: parameterMysteryTouch

Added by: Roy McElmurry on 2013/04/01

What output is produced by the following program?

public class MysteryTouch {
    public static void main(String[] args) { 
        String head = "shoulders"; 
        String knees = "toes"; 
        String elbow = "head"; 
        String eye = "eyes and ears"; 
        String ear = "eye"; 

        touch(ear, elbow); 
        touch(elbow, ear); 
        touch(head, "elbow"); 
        touch(eye, eye); 
        touch(knees, "Toes"); 
        touch(head, "knees " + knees); 
    }
    
    public static void touch(String elbow, String ear) { 
        System.out.println("touch your " + elbow + " to your " + ear); 
    }
}
touch(ear, elbow);
touch(elbow, ear);
touch(head, "elbow");
touch(eye, eye);
touch(knees, "Toes");
touch(head, "knees " + knees);

You must log in before you can solve this problem.

user
Log In

If you do not understand how to solve a problem or why your solution code doesn't work, please contact your TA or instructor.

If something seems wrong with the Practice-It system itself (errors, slow performance, incorrect problem descriptions/tests, etc.), please contact us.

Is there a problem?
Contact a Practice-It administrator.